Jamaica's Cool Runners: Pushcarts and the Art of Living offers a fascinating glimpse into a slice of Jamaican culture that’s often overlooked. It’s about more than just pushcarts; it’s a meditation on creativity, community, and the joy of life on the island. The documentary has this laid-back vibe, perfect for showcasing how these hand-crafted vehicles symbolize resourcefulness and innovation. You get to see the artistry behind each pushcart and also some personal stories that make it more than a mere showcase. The pacing is leisurely, like a Sunday afternoon in the sun, allowing you to soak in the warmth of the atmosphere. It’s a charming exploration of how something so simple can embody a way of life.
